Default Do you think we’ll ever see another knuckleballer?

I’ve always enjoyed watching knuckleball pitchers. Will we ever get another Wakefield or Niekro? Looks like there was a 33 year old rookie that threw a knuckleball that got to pitch 3 innings in 21’ for the Orioles but outside of that I think Steven Wright is the last one we’ve gotten to see on a regular basis.

I think there are a couple in the minors now. Mickey Jannis pitched in one game for Orioles in 2021 but it looks like he got hit hard in independent leagues last year. As long as there is Wakefield or someone around to pass on the knowledge there will always be someone in the minors on the verge of being out of professional baseball that will experiment with the knuckleball as a last ditch effort to save their career.
